Drain clearing services involve removing blockages and debris from a property's plumbing system to ensure water flows smoothly through pipes and drains. This process typically includes using specialized tools and equipment to clear clogs caused by grease, hair, soap buildup, or foreign objects. Proper drain clearing helps prevent backups, slow draining, and unpleasant odors that can develop when drains are obstructed. Regular maintenance or urgent repairs can both benefit from professional drain clearing to keep plumbing systems functioning efficiently.

Many common problems signal the need for drain clearing services. Homeowners may notice water pooling in sinks, bathtubs, or floor drains, or experience slow drainage that disrupts daily routines. Frequent clogs or recurring backups in kitchen or bathroom drains can indicate deeper blockages that require professional attention. Additionally, foul smells emanating from drains or gurgling sounds during use often point to obstructions or venting issues that need to be addressed promptly to prevent further plumbing problems.

The overview below groups typical Drain Clearing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Brandon, FL.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- For routine drain clearing jobs like minor clogs or blockages, local service providers often charge between $150 and $350. Many common issues fall within this range, making it a typical cost for standard maintenance or minor repairs.

Moderate Clearing Services - More involved drain cleaning, such as clearing larger obstructions or addressing multiple drains, usually costs between $350 and $600. These projects are common for residential properties requiring detailed cleaning or partial pipe work.

Extensive Repairs - Complex drain issues, including damaged pipes or recurring blockages, can range from $600 to $1,200. Fewer projects reach this tier, but they often involve significant work to resolve underlying problems.

Full Drain Replacement - Complete drain or sewer line replacements are larger projects that typically cost $3,000 or more, with some complex cases exceeding $5,000. These are less frequent but necessary for severe damage or long-term solutions.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es drain clogs in residential plumbing? Common causes include accumulated debris, grease buildup, hair, and foreign objects that obstruct the flow within pipes.

How can I tell if my drain is clogged? Signs include slow draining water, gurgling sounds, or unpleasant odors emanating from the drain.

Are chemical drain cleaners safe to use? Chemical cleaners can sometimes damage pipes or cause health issues; it's advisable to consult with a local service provider for safe alternatives.

What types of drains do drain clearing services typically handle? They commonly service kitchen sinks, bathroom drains, toilets, and main sewer lines.

How do local contractors clear stubborn or deep blockages? They often use specialized tools like augers or hydro-jetting equipment to effectively remove tough obstructions.
